Why Klarna doesn’t work for UK casino deposits

Klarna is a buy now, pay later service. It makes sense for a £200 pair of trainers. It makes no sense for a £20 deposit on a slot. Regulators and payment networks know this. Klarna’s own merchant agreement prohibits gambling, betting, and any transaction tied to a gambling licence. The company has updated its terms multiple times and does not allow its payment rails to be used by UK Gambling Commission licensees. Attempts to route casino deposits through Klarna using a middleman, usually a digital wallet, get blocked or frozen. Some older casino pages still list Klarna as a payment method, but if you try to deposit, the option either doesn’t appear or the transaction fails. UK-facing casinos stopped advertising Klarna around 2021, and the few that kept the logo up simply forgot to remove it.

There is also a structural problem. Klarna’s core product is credit. You get the goods now, pay later. Gambling with borrowed money is exactly what responsible gambling frameworks want to prevent. The UKGC’s remote technical standards and licence conditions place strict limits on credit card gambling, and while Klarna is not a credit card, it carries similar risk. No UK-licensed operator wants to be the casino that encouraged punters to chase losses on a delayed payment. That reputational risk outweighs any convenience Klarna might bring.

So the short version: Klarna has drawn a red line around gambling. It is not a technical limitation. It is a policy decision. And that policy has not changed as of early 2026.

What happened to Klarna casinos in the UK?

Between 2019 and 2021, a handful of casino sites experimented with Klarna through its Sofort banking product. Sofort, which Klarna acquired in 2014, was a real-time bank transfer system popular in Germany and Austria. Some UK casinos accepted Sofort under the Klarna umbrella, and affiliate sites started pumping out ‘Klarna casino’ lists. The payment method was never mainstream. It was a workaround for players who didn’t want to use cards or e-wallets.

Then Klarna tightened its gambling policy. By late 2021, Sofort was no longer offered for casino deposits at any UKGC-licensed site. Klarna also removed several high-risk merchant categories, including gambling, from its buy now pay later network. Affiliates and casino review sites were slow to update, which is why you still see outdated pages promising Klarna deposits. Search engines keep indexing them because people keep searching for the phrase. The reality is that no UK casino has offered Klarna as a deposit method since 2022.

If you see a casino advertising Klarna today, check the licence. It is almost certainly an offshore site without UKGC approval. Those sites operate in legal grey areas, and your money is not protected. The UK Gambling Commission does not license any operator that accepts Klarna directly, and any site claiming otherwise is either lying or using a different product under the Klarna brand without permission.

How to deposit at UK casinos without Klarna

You have better options than Klarna. The UK casino market has moved on. Debit card deposits are instant and protected by your bank. PayPal adds a layer of separation between your bank and the casino, which some players prefer. Trustly uses open banking to move money directly from your bank account without sharing card details. MuchBetter is a prepaid-style e-wallet built specifically for gambling. Apple Pay is accepted at a growing number of UK casinos and works on iPhone without entering card numbers.

Each method has its own rhythm. Debit cards are the default, but some banks block gambling transactions unless you opt in. PayPal withdrawals usually land within 24 hours. Trustly is fast but requires you to log in to your bank. MuchBetter often processes withdrawals in under 12 hours. Apple Pay deposits are instant, but you cannot withdraw to Apple Pay; the casino will send winnings back to your linked card or bank. None of these methods require a credit check, and none carry the risk of spending money you don’t have.

If you were drawn to Klarna because it felt safer than typing your card details, look at PayPal or MuchBetter. Both let you deposit without handing your bank credentials to the casino. If you wanted Klarna because it offered pay later, then you should stay away from gambling with borrowed money anyway. The UKGC banned credit card gambling in 2020 for exactly that reason. Klarna is not a credit card, but the principle is the same: do not fund a bet with money you have not yet earned.

Are there any Klarna-style workarounds still available?

Short answer: no, not with Klarna. Any casino that still displays a Klarna logo on its cashier page is either offshore or using a misleading image. Klarna’s payment API will reject the casino’s merchant category code, so even if you select Klarna at checkout, the transaction will not go through. Some sites try to route Klarna through an intermediary e-wallet, but Klarna blocks those too when the destination is a gambling operator. In 2026, the workaround does not exist.

If you want the closest thing to Klarna’s ‘pay by bank’ feel, use Trustly. It is a direct bank transfer that verifies your identity through your online banking. You never enter card details, and the money moves in real time. Trustly does not offer pay later, but that is a good thing for gambling. If you want a digital wallet that feels light and fast, MuchBetter is closer to the Klarna app experience than PayPal. MuchBetter has a clean mobile app, instant top-ups, and no gambling transaction fees at most UK casinos.

How to choose a safe UK casino if you were looking for Klarna

First, check the licence. Every casino on this page holds a UK Gambling Commission licence. That means your deposits are segregated from company funds, disputes go to an independent adjudicator, and the casino must follow strict anti-money laundering and responsible gambling rules. If a site offers Klarna and claims to be licensed, check the licence number on the UKGC register. You will not find one.

Second, look at the bonus terms before you sign up. A welcome offer that looks generous is often loaded with 40x or 50x wagering on the bonus and deposit. That is not a gift; it is a retention tool. The UKGC now requires casinos to display key terms clearly, but players still get caught out. Compare the wagering requirement, the game weighting, and the time limit. A no-wagering free spins offer, like the one PlayOJO runs, is often worth more in practice than a big match bonus.

Third, consider withdrawal speed. Many UK casinos advertise ‘fast withdrawals’ but then hold your money for 48 hours of pending time. Look for casinos that process withdrawals within 24 hours and offer e-wallets like PayPal or MuchBetter. The pending period is entirely under the casino’s control, and a long one is a red flag. Finally, check the game selection. If you play slots, make sure the casino has titles from NetEnt, Play’n GO, Pragmatic Play, or other major studios. If you prefer live dealer, confirm the casino has Evolution or Playtech tables.

Can I use Klarna at any UK online casino in 2026?

No. Klarna prohibits gambling transactions in its terms, and no UK Gambling Commission licensed casino accepts Klarna as a deposit or withdrawal method. Any site claiming otherwise is likely offshore or using outdated marketing. Use debit card, PayPal, Trustly, or MuchBetter instead.

Are there any casinos that accept Klarna via Sofort?

Sofort was removed from UK casino cashiers in 2021 after Klarna tightened its gambling policy. Today you cannot use Sofort or any Klarna-owned product for UK casino deposits. The payment method simply no longer appears at licensed operators.

What is the best alternative to Klarna for casino deposits?

MuchBetter and Trustly come closest to Klarna’s convenience. MuchBetter is a mobile-first e-wallet with instant deposits and fast withdrawals. Trustly offers direct bank payments without card details. PayPal is also widely accepted and has strong buyer protection.

Why did Klarna ban gambling transactions?

Klarna’s acceptable use policy has excluded gambling for years, and the company reinforced that stance after acquiring Sofort. Gambling with borrowed money poses regulatory and reputational risks, and Klarna does not want its pay later product associated with betting losses.

Can I get a Klarna cash advance to fund a casino account?

That is a terrible idea and likely against Klarna’s terms. Klarna does not offer cash advances; its credit lines are for purchases at approved merchants. Trying to use Klarna to indirectly fund gambling violates the user agreement and can result in account closure.
